Collaborative Resolutions Group, Inc. Collaborative Resolutions Group (CRG) is an independent nonprofit community mediation center.

Collaborative Resolutions Group (CRG) is a comprehensive conflict resolution/transformation and training organization dedicated to helping individuals, schools, businesses, and community organizations resolve conflict, or recognize and accept difference, and increase their capacity for effective communication. CRG offers Mediation and Facilitation to navigate a broad range of disputes, including c

onsumer, housing, divorce, family, parent-teen, elder, workplace, and neighborhood. Our School Restorative Practices program supports student leadership and voice, working with teachers and school administrators to make systemic changes to traditional disciplinary practices. Conflict Coaching is offered to individuals facing challenging interactions or who wish to work one-on-one to increase communication effectiveness. Training in conflict resolution/transformation, teamwork and mediation is available to individuals and organizations. "Middle school was a very difficult time for me (as it was for many). I was experiencing complex social issues with my peers, and I did not know how to properly handle them. Looking back, I really wish I had a platform to help me properly communicate with my peers, I think something like that would have greatly benefited me during that time. I see peer mediation as an opportunity to give to the community something that I would have loved so much in the past. High school is notoriously a hard time socially, and I want to do my part to help my peers navigate that!" - 11th grade CRG Peer Mediator
